A church father on this verse
Remember, therefore, my beloved friend, that thou hast been redeemed by the flesh of our Lord, re-established by His blood; and "holding the Head, from which the whole body of the Church, having been fitted together, takes increase" -that is, acknowledging the advent in the flesh of the Son of God, and [His] divinity,…
Irenaeus, 3th c. — Against Heresies Book V
